Interviews: Annam Manthiram

annam-manthiram-headshot

Annam Manthiram wrote her first story when she was in kindergarten. It was about an evil pig and an evil family and had a happy ending. She was hooked after that.

Since, Annam has written two novels, The Goju Story and After the Tsunami (Stephen F. Austin State University Press, 2011; Finalist, 2012 NM/AZ Book Awards). Her short story collection (Dysfunction) was also a Finalist in both the 2010 Elixir Press and Leapfrog Press fiction contests and was published by Aqueous Books in December of 2012.

A graduate of the M.A. Writing program at the University of Southern California, Ms. Manthiram resides in New Mexico with her husband, Alex, and sons, Sathya and Anand. So far, she’s quite enchanted.
